Gaf (real name unknown, born October, 1977 in the United Kingdom) is a wrestler best-known for his runs in both the Xtreme Championship Wrestling and the World Revolutionary Wrestling Federation.

History

Gaf entered the wrestling spot light when he joined XCW’s farm league, ACW (Amateur Championship Wrestling). It was there where Gaf learnt his trade under the watchful eye of Ty Dhomie and dramatically improved. Although he lost his first competitive match in a fiercely fought contest to JTV, he would soon rise above them all by becoming the ACW World Champion when he destroyed Rocky Blonde after a bizarre sequence of events that actually started off with a none title tag team match been scheduled. Gaf embraced his first major belt and enjoyed the success he achieved. However, it didn’t last for too long as he lost it to Bobby Idol in a controversial fashion, which saw his former mentor Ty Dhomie betray him.

However, Gaf’s biggest achievement was to follow, which was promotion to XCW. Despite his potential, Gaf soon found him down the lower reaches of the rankings after an unconvincing victory over Nighthawk, a tag team loss and a defeat to Joe Leonard. However, Gaf regained some confidence and got back to winning ways when he gained revenge over his archrival JTV in a brutal barbed wire match. However, XCW collapsed for a short period of time and Gaf’s momentum was put to a halt. When XCW went temporally out of business, Gaf found it hard to get back on track and soon found himself living it rough and was made homeless. However, in a bizarre twist of fate, XCW reopened and after reading an XCW advert in a bin ridden newspaper he smuggled himself into America to restart his dream. However, XCW failed to live up to expectations and soon closed but only after Gaf had recorded an easy victory over Xavier Anns, improved his reputation by fighting off Shadow and became TV champion when he defeated Ty Dhomie and Blake Lane in a triple threat match.

Meanwhile, throughout this period Gaf was hired to join the World Revolutionary Wrestling Federation. His first stay lasted over 6 months, where he kept the world championship for the majority of this time. He also won the tag team title with Sweet and Tender Hooligan and formed the stable The Hooligans. However after falling out with President Warren, Gaf decided to leave the federation. Gafa returned some months later after he was hired by the new president, Kevin Rouser to take care of some business. He once again regained the world title shortly before the federation collapsed. Despite his success, his time spent in the WRWF is often disregarded in terms of importance as the quality of opposition was much less and it often seemed like Gaf was not trying as hard as he should have been.

Gaf temporarily joined a federation going by the name of American Championship Wrestling, where he managed to defeat Bestrom and become the Intercontinental champion. Gaf then dissappeared from ACW. Shortly afterwards videos began circulating of him being held hostage by Shawn Murphy. Gaf later revealed that it was an elaborate ploy and that he was indeed working in unison with Murphy. Gaf then quit ACW due to "personal differences" with the federations owners the Hayes brothers. His Intercontinental title was then vacated. Gaf was undefeated in ACW in single matches.

He was offered a contract a New Era Wrestling but it is thought that Gaf declined the offer to concentrate on ventures outside the wrestling ring.

Gaf has not been seen for many years, although rumours have circulated of him hanging round with former XCW wrestler Robert Vallant in England.

Moves

Trademark Moves

  • Bitter Sweet Harmony-20 second Torture Rack hold released into a Samoan Drop
  • Choke Slam
  • The Lecture- A standing sharpshooter.
  • Momentum Swinger- Gaf stands behind his opponent and pulls their right arm though their legs with his right arm. He hooks their neck with his left arm, lifts them up over his head crosswise. Gaf then quickly spins around three times with him safely gripping their body before slamming them down to the mat as hard as he possible can.
  • The Tonic-Gaf dazes his opponent with a strong European Uppercut and then twists rounds so his back-to-back with his opponent and then hooks each of his arms with his opponents and then kneels down lifting his opponent off the ground and forcing his shoulders to the mat for a pin.
  • The Conclusion-Gaf throws his opponent up on his shoulder, belly-up and head forward, then slams them head-first into the mat.
  • Sweet And Sour Sideslam-Sidewalk Slam

Finisher Move

  • Fatal Floor Slam- Gaf picks up his opponent and locks them into a double hand choke hold. Gaf then lifts his opponent up by his neck and forces them into a choke lift. Gaf then grabs his opponent’s legs and dives down into a sit-down powerbomb.
